Abbott wins GOP primary nomination in race for open Spartanburg County Council seat
Republican voters on the eastern side of Spartanburg County went to the polls to select a nominee for Spartanburg County Council District 3.
With 100% of the vote counted, Paul Abbott defeated Jason Lynch, 3,555 to 2,400.
The two men were in a runoff race on Aug. 19 after emerging as the top two vote-getters in the Republican primary two weeks earlier.
The development of new residential subdivisions was a major theme in the primary.
The eastern section of Spartanburg County has not grown at the same rate as much of the rest of the county over the past few decades. But the east side tide has been rising lately.
Residents have expressed concern about the development of new subdivisions and the impact on roads and other infrastructure.
Abbott will take on Democrat Kathryn Harvey and Sarah Gonzalez, of the Forward Party, in November.
The District 3 seat became open when longtime council member David Britt resigned to take a position with the South Carolina Public Service Commission.
